Jimbo......I would try and remove the icons without using system restore just to be on the safe side. Go into your control panel / Add or remove programs....... see if there's any new additions in there that you didn't download ......if there are delete them .....I dont think they came from Micro Soft .  The other thing you could try is reboot into safe mode and see if you can delete them from there . If they are only shortcuts then there must be a small app lurking somewhere in your pc .....right click on the icons and select properties.....that may lead you to were they are hiding .
As robertmillar suggested ....using another browser really isnt fixing the problem........because you do need IE.

I have sucessfully removed similar icons. Go to http://lop.com They have removal instructions on what to remove via the control panel, and if that doesn't work (as in my case) they have an uninstaller that can be downloaded. When I ran it I was told that there were only remaining bits of the original installation left and was given the opportunity to remove them. As a bonus it also removed the unwanted popup that always came up and sat on the top of my home page.
